Questions people actually ask

What's the best runner gift under £25?
Merino running socks or a rechargeable head torch. Both get used weekly, both are the premium version of something runners cheap out on for themselves.
What's the best runner gift between £25 and £50?
Open-ear headphones for road safety, a compact massage gun for recovery, or a race bib frame for sentiment. Three different flavours, all reliably loved.
Do runners like gift vouchers?
